AP: A luge athlete from Georgia, Nodar Kumaritashvili, was killed in a crash in training on the Olympic track at the Whistler Sliding Center on Friday, an Olympic luge official at the track confirmed, the worst case scenario developing on a track that many competitors have said is too fast.

Mohawk Valley native Erin Hamlin has become the first American to win an Olympic medal in singles luge.
Editor's note: On February 11, 2014, Erin Hamlin finished third in the singles luge event, becoming the first American athlete to win an Olympic medal in the event.
